The clever hacker and homebrew community over at XDA forums have come up with an alternate exe file that will apparently allow non-dev unlocked phones to be backed up, then pointed at the Mango Beta update servers to get Mango onto the handset.
http://forum.xda-developers.com/show....php?t=1149265 Many are reporting success. HOWEVER, if you are thinking about doing this - consider: 1) MS are unlikely to be as supportive again as they were with "Walshied" Phones at NoDo release from the Chevron team tools saga. 2) This will invalidate your warranty and your phone will not have any official support (OEM, Carrier, MS) as soon as you hit go. 3) If you lose your backup....there may be no way to get the official Mango update when later released. The oficial upgrade path from the beta Mango program is to restore NoDo then resume regular updates once released. So - the link is there, for good or evil. As a last comment - if you have your mind set on giving it a go - make sure you follow the instructions explicitly. 1 mistake will screw you. <no liability or responsibility for any that click on that link!> Sheeds.
